MySQL 8.0详细安装与配置教程
175 浏览量
更新于2024-08-03
收藏 482KB DOCX 举报
"MySQL 8.0 的安装与配置教程"
MySQL是世界上最受欢迎的开源关系型数据库管理系统之一。本文将详细讲解如何在Windows环境下安装并配置MySQL 8.0。
首先,你需要从官方网站下载MySQL 8.0的安装包,然后将其解压缩到你选择的目录。例如,这里假设你将其解压到了`D:\MySqlDB\mysql-8.0.20-winx64`。
安装的第二步是设置环境变量。你需要找到MySQL的`bin`目录(在这个例子中是`D:\MySqlDB\mysql-8.0.20-winx64\bin`),然后将其添加到系统的PATH环境变量中。这样,你可以在任何位置通过命令行启动MySQL的相关工具。
接着,配置MySQL服务器的关键是创建`my.ini`文件。在MySQL的根目录下新建这个文件,并添加必要的配置参数。这些参数包括:
- `port=3306`:设置服务器监听的默认端口。
- `basedir`:设定MySQL的安装路径。
- `datadir`:指定数据文件的存放位置,这里应指向你希望存放数据库文件的目录。
- `max_connections`:定义最大并发连接数。
- `max_connect_errors`:允许的最大连接失败次数。
- `character-set-server=utf8mb4`:设置服务器默认的字符集为UTF8MB4,支持更多Unicode字符。
- `default-storage-engine=INNODB`:指定默认的存储引擎为InnoDB,它提供了事务处理和支持外键的能力。
- `default_authentication_plugin=mysql_native_password`:设置默认的认证插件为`mysql_native_password`。
对于客户端配置,也需要在`my.ini`中设置`default-character-set=utf8mb4`,确保客户端的默认字符集与服务器一致。
完成配置后,需要初始化MySQL服务器。打开命令提示符,以管理员权限运行,输入`mysqld --initialize --console`。这一步会生成一个临时的root用户的密码,你需要记录下来。
接着,使用`mysqld --install`命令安装MySQL服务。如果成功,系统会显示“Service successfully installed”。
至此,MySQL 8.0的基础安装与配置已完成。但你还需要启动服务,可以通过命令`net start mysql`来启动MySQL服务。然后,你可以使用`mysql -u root -p`命令,输入之前生成的临时密码,登录MySQL服务器。
为了安全,你应该立即更改root用户的密码。在MySQL命令行界面中,执行`ALTER USER 'root'@'localhost' IDENTIFIED BY '你的新密码';`。
至此,MySQL 8.0已经成功安装并配置完毕,你可以开始创建数据库和用户,进行数据操作了。记住,定期更新和备份你的数据库是保持数据安全的重要步骤。
2024-03-18 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-06-28 上传
点击了解资源详情
weixin_42710590
- 粉丝: 20
- 资源: 1
最新资源
- Aspose资源包:转PDF无水印学习工具
- Go语言控制台输入输出操作教程
- 红外遥控报警器原理及应用详解下载
- 控制卷筒纸侧面位置的先进装置技术解析
- 易语言加解密例程源码详解与实践
- SpringMVC客户管理系统:Hibernate与Bootstrap集成实践
- 深入理解JavaScript Set与WeakSet的使用
- 深入解析接收存储及发送装置的广播技术方法
- zyString模块1.0源码公开-易语言编程利器
- Android记分板UI设计:SimpleScoreboard的简洁与高效
- 量子网格列设置存储组件:开源解决方案
- 全面技术源码合集:CcVita Php Check v1.1
- 中军创易语言抢购软件:付款功能解析
- Python手动实现图像滤波教程
- MATLAB源代码实现基于DFT的量子传输分析
- 开源程序Hukoch.exe:简化食谱管理与导入功能